Choose Your Transport Wisely**:

πŸ’‘

Car**: Offers flexibility and scenic views along the coast. The drive takes about 2 hours via I-95 S.

πŸ’‘

Train**: Amtrak operates services between the two cities, providing a comfortable ride. Check schedules in advance for availability.

πŸ’‘

Bus**: Greyhound and other services have frequent routes, often at budget-friendly prices. Book tickets online for discounts.

πŸ’‘

Flight**: While possible, flying is less efficient due to the short distance; consider other options.

Transport Options

Traveling from Savannah to Jacksonville offers several convenient transportation options. By car, the journey takes about 2 hours, making it the fastest choice for those who prefer flexibility and want to explore along the way. Bus services are available, with travel times around 3.5 hours, ideal for budget-conscious travelers. For those looking for a more leisurely experience, taking a train is an option, with journeys typically lasting around 4 hours. Flights are less practical given the short distance, as they involve additional time for airport procedures. Ultimately, driving is recommended for families or groups, while buses are great for solo travelers or those seeking cost-effective travel.
